How Long is Player Career Mode in FIFA 23?

As an avid FIFA gamer and content creator, one of the most common questions I see is "how long is player career mode FIFA 23?" So let‘s dive into the details and breakdown exactly what to expect.

The short answer is: you can play for up to 15 full seasons in FIFA 23‘s player career mode. After completing the 15th season, your career will end and you‘ll need to start a brand new one.

An Overview of Player Career Mode in FIFA 23

For those new to the series, player career mode allows you to create your own custom player, design their appearance, attributes, positions, and more. You can then join any club team and control just that player as you progress from a young prospect to established star.

It‘s an addictively fun way to carve out your own unique path to stardom in the beautiful game. And you have ample time to build your legend over 15 full seasons.

Some key things to highlight about player career mode in FIFA 23:

  • New Highlights System: Skip right to the key moments and playable highlights from each match rather than playing full 90 minute games if you choose. Great way to blast through seasons faster.
  • Cinematics: Special cutscenes when you complete high-profile transfers, get called up to your national team, or mark major career milestones. Makes your journey feel more cinematic.
  • Volta Integration: Unlock cosmetic gear, tattoos, emotes and more from Volta to customize your pro‘s look. Carry your style from the streets to the stadium.
  • New Transfer Options: Take control of contract negotiations with potential suitors and have a bigger say in determining your next club destination.

What Happens After You Finish 15 Seasons

Once you reach the end of that 15th season and complete your final match, you‘ll be greeted with a special message congratulating you on an incredible career in FIFA‘s player career mode.

Unfortunately, that career must then end and you‘ll have to start a brand new one with a new created pro if you wish to keep playing.

The game does not allow you to circumvent or extend beyond that 15 season limit. This applies universally whether you‘re playing FIFA 23 on PS5, Xbox Series X|S, PC or legacy consoles like PS4 and Xbox One.

So in summary:

  • 15 seasons max from 2022/23 until 2036/2037
  • Career ends with congratulatory message after final match of 15th season
  • Must start a new career if you want to keep playing after

This limit has been in place for a number of FIFA titles now and helps keep each career feeling meaningful before the next iteration of the game comes out.
